You have a unique opportunity to become an original “Plank Owner” of the STORIS MUSEUM.  An original plank owner is a special person or organization, such as yourself, who has been provided with a once-in-a-lifetime opportunity to participate in the initial phase of obtaining approval from Congress as well as the backing of the State of Alaska and the City and Borough of Juneau in establishing STORIS as a museum and education center and training vessel.  The museum will be located in the heart of Juneau for anyone with an interest in maritime history to explore and become further educated.  Names of the original plank owners will be displayed on a suitable plaque prominently displayed in the passageway on the port side of the ship leading aft from the crew’s mess deck.  Additionally, the names will be listed in a searchable database on the Museum’s website.
